In 1980, Florida Special Act, Chapter 80-585 was enacted, creating the Pinellas County Emergency Medical Services Authority governed by the Board of County Commissioners (BOCC) of Pinellas County. Regional 9-1-1, a division of Safety & Emergency Services, operates as the single primary public safety answering point (PSAP) for all 911 calls originating in the county. The county estimates the average response times for non-emergency calls could go up five minutes, but the response times could go down for calls for heart attacks, drownings and other life or death scenarios.
